Also known as: Penang Hokkien Mee, Hae Mee, Prawn Noodle
A flavorful and aromatic noodle soup with a rich broth.
Rich, savory, and deeply umami with a strong prawn flavor, often with a mild spicy kick.
Yellow egg noodles, rice vermicelli, prawns, pork slices, bean sprouts, water spinach (kangkung), hard-boiled egg.
The broth is typically made by simmering prawn heads and shells with pork bones for hours.
